.首先生成数字证书:

使用JDK的keytool命令,生成证书(包含证书/公钥/私钥)到D:\ssl.keystore:keytool -genkey -keystore "D:\ssl.keystore" -alias localhost -keyalg RSA

Tomcat9配置SSL连接

2.配置TOMCAT

修改TOMCAT_HOME\conf\server.xml文件,将以下内容粘贴到Tomcat配置文件中

<Connector
           protocol="org.apache.coyote.http11.Http11NioProtocol"
           port="8443" maxThreads="200"
           scheme="https" secure="true" SSLEnabled="true"
           keystoreFile="F:\ssl.keystore" keystorePass="123456"
           clientAuth="false" sslProtocol="TLS"/>

其中keystorePass替换成设置的密码。

保存后启动Tomcat,访问https://localhost:8443即可

Tomcat9配置SSL连接

因为CA证书是自己生成的不被浏览器认可所以会被当做不安全网站,但不影响使用。

 

相关文章:

  • 2021-07-04
  • 2021-11-02
  • 2021-08-08
  • 2021-10-10
  • 2021-12-13
猜你喜欢
  • 2022-12-23
  • 2022-02-07
  • 2021-08-17
  • 2021-11-08
  • 2022-12-23
  • 2021-12-24
  • 2021-10-19
相关资源
相似解决方案